A crazy week in Zimbabwe. How did we get here? | Point of View with Kuda Mangwe

Zimbabwe’s military was in the streets last week for the first time since post-election violence in August in which six people were killed.

This time, people reported being hunted down in their homes by security forces and severely beaten. Doctors treated dozens of gunshot wounds.

More than 600 people were arrested, with most denied bail.
